|
||||
江苏常州电缆废旧电缆当场结算
显然,过程映像区并不能涵盖整个CPU的输入/输出地址区域。当我们要访问的I/O地址超出了过程映像区的范围,就必须使用外设寻址了。CPU315-2DP的技术数据(节选)对于400的CPU而言,以CPU-4162DP为例(如所示),输入/输出均16KB,过程映像区默认为512个字节,但可调整为16KB。当访问地址超出了默认的过程映像区范围时,我们就要以下选择了:或者修改过程映像区的大小或者采用外设寻址CPU416-2DP的技术数据(节选)输入/输出模块地址未分配给过程映像区特别是对于S7-400系列CPU而言,要想使用过程映像区,需给输入/输出模块地址分配过程映像,OB1-P 进阶笔记2:过程映像区的分类及其更新机制》一文)。PLC输入口和输出口的电流定额PLC自带的输入口电源一般为DC24v,输入口每一个点的电流定额在5mA-7mA之间,这个电流是输入口短接时产生的电流,当输入口有一定的负载时,其流过的电流会相应减少。PLC输入信号传递所需的电流一般为2mA,为了保证的有效信号输入电流,输入端口所接设备的总阻抗一般要小于2K欧。也就是说当输入端口的传感器功率较大时候,需要接单独的外部电源。PLC输出端口一般所能通过的电流随PLC机型的不同而不同,大部分在1A~2A之间,当负载的电流大于PLC的端口额定电流的值时,一般需要增加中间继电器才能连接外部接触器或者是其他设备。比较指令CMP1).16位运算(CMP、CMPP)对比较值S1和比较源S2的内容进行比较,根据其结果(小、一致、大),使D+D+2其中一个为ON。源数据SS2,作为BIN(二进制)的值进行。按代数形式进行大小的比较。:-10<22).32位运算(DCMP、DCMPP)对比较值[S1+1,S1]和比较源[S2+1,S2]的内容进行比较,根据其结果(小,一致,大),使D+D+2其中一个为ON。Busy表示功能块执行情况的输出,如果为高电平,表示功能块正在执行。我们读取它的下降沿,来触发下一次操作。Error是功能块的错误,可能你会有疑问,为什么通信错误不用这个信号呢?其实这个错误表示的范围更广,它表示功能块检测到错误就报,有时候,我们通信正常,但是当我们读取的数据有问题,或是参数设置不正确时,也会报错,而我在程序中的错误仅仅是通信不上的错误,也就是,这个Error表示的范围更广泛,它更适合我们调试的时候监控。 |
|